Antecedentes

In December 2015, countries adopted the new historic Paris Agreement on climate change. For the first time, 195 Parties to the UN Framework Convention on Climate Change (UNFCCC) pledged to curb emissions, strengthen resilience and joined to take common climate action. This followed two weeks of negotiations at the United Nations climate change conference (COP21).

This new commitment cover all the crucial areas identified as essential for a landmark conclusion:

- Mitigation – reducing emissions fast enough to achieve the temperature goal;

- A transparency system and global stock-take– accounting for climate action;

- Adaptation – strengthening ability of countries to deal with climate impacts;

- Loss and damage – strengthening ability to recover from climate impacts; and

- Support – including finance, for nations to build clean, resilient futures.
